diff --git a/docs/my-website/docs/troubleshoot/ui_issues.md b/docs/my-website/docs/troubleshoot/ui_issues.md new file mode 100644 index 00000000000..90912b1daeb --- /dev/null +++ b/docs/my-website/docs/troubleshoot/ui_issues.md @@ -0,0 +1,49 @@ +# UI Troubleshooting + +If you're experiencing issues with the LiteLLM Admin UI, please include the following information when reporting. + +## 1. Steps to Reproduce + +A clear, step-by-step description of how to trigger the issue (e.g., "Navigate to Settings → Team, click 'Create Team', fill in fields, click submit → error appears"). + +## 2. LiteLLM Version + +The current version of LiteLLM you're running. Check via `litellm --version` or the UI's settings page. + +## 3. Architecture & Deployment Setup + +Distributed environments are a known source of UI issues. Please describe: + +- **Number of LiteLLM instances/replicas** and how they are deployed (e.g., Kubernetes, Docker Compose, ECS) +- **Load balancer** type and configuration (e.g., ALB, Nginx, Cloudflare Tunnel) — include whether sticky sessions are enabled +- **How the UI is accessed** — directly via LiteLLM, through a reverse proxy, or behind an ingress controller +- **Any CDN or caching layers** between the user and the LiteLLM server + +## 4. Network Tab Requests + +Open your browser's Developer Tools (F12 → Network tab), reproduce the issue, and share: + +- The **failing request(s)** — URL, method, status code, and response body +- **Screenshots or HAR export** of the relevant network activity +- Any **CORS or mixed-content errors** shown in the Console tab + +## 5. Environment Variables + +Non-sensitive environment variables related to the UI and proxy setup, such as: + +- `LITELLM_MASTER_KEY` +- `PROXY_BASE_URL` / `LITELLM_PROXY_BASE_URL` +- `UI_BASE_PATH` +- Any SSO-related variables (e.g., `GOOGLE_CLIENT_ID`, `MICROSOFT_TENANT`) + +Do **not** include passwords, secrets, or API keys. + +## 6. Browser & Access Details + +- **Browser** and version (e.g., Chrome 120, Firefox 121) +- **Access URL** used to reach the UI (redact sensitive parts) +- Whether the issue occurs for **all users or specific roles** (Admin, Internal User, etc.) + +## 7. Screenshots or Screen Recordings + +A screenshot or short screen recording of the issue is extremely helpful. Include any visible error messages, toasts, or unexpected behavior.
